Group 15 elements generally form covalent compounds. However the two elements from group 15 nitrogen and phosphorus are known to form nitride (N3-) and phosphide (P3-) ions as in Na3N or Na3P.

Inorganic chemistry is known as such because it does not include organic compounds. Some examples of organic compounds are carbon based compounds, hydrocarbons, and the derivatives of these two groups. Organic compounds generally include the elements carbon, hydrogen, oxygen, the halogen group, and elements such as silicon, sulfur, and phosphorus.
